MEMO — Kettling Depot Receiving

Uniform sets for the new Kettling depot arrive Wednesday via Ashgrove courier: 40 boxes, sorted by size, manifest attached to box one. Check the count at the dock before signing; shortages go straight to stores, not the courier. The hand-over instruction the courier will follow is set out below.

drop instructions, tafof-baguf: the holmir gilox courier leaves the sormir ulaok holdor ledger at gate 5596 under passcode 257343

# Glyphbin Environments

Glyphbin vendors all third-party fonts used by the Orrery rendering service. No runtime fetches from foundry CDNs; every font file is checked into the vendored tree, hashed, and verified at build. Staging and prod pull from the same immutable font bundle, so a diff between environments means tampering, not drift. License texts ship alongside each family. Security review scope: hash verification step, bundle signing, and the allowlist of permitted formats. Each environment boots with the values below.

settings of tagef-bawif:
DRUIX_HOST=druix.zemvarlabs.internal
DRUIX_PORT=8000

**Minutes — Management Meeting, Support Outsourcing**

Attendees: ops, finance, and CX leads at Pellbrook Retail.

We agreed to move tier-1 support to an external partner by Q2, keeping tier-2 in-house at the Marwyn office. Finance estimates roughly 18% cost savings once the transition settles. Concerns raised about handover quality — a 60-day shadow period was approved. Vendor shortlist due in two weeks. Rationale tied to broader plans is captured below.

internal memo for kawip-hadug: Headcount on the Wenwyn team goes from 7 to 140 by the end of January. Gross margin on Wenwyn came in at 20 percent against a plan of 15 percent.